What Are Business IT Solutions
Business IT solutions cover all the technology and services that help a business run better. The right systems should align with your goals, safeguard your data, and enhance your team’s efficiency—not just be about having the latest tools.
Managed IT services, which offer solutions like 24/7 tech support, regular maintenance to prevent issues, stronger security against cyber threats, and software updates for smooth system operation. Cloud computing is another valuable solution, providing benefits such as remote file access, automatic backups, and cost savings. Cybersecurity solutions are also essential and should include firewalls, data encryption, and staff training to protect against cybercrime. Data analytics & business intelligence tools can help businesses understand customer behaviour, identify inefficiencies, and plan for the future. Effective small business IT solutions are affordable, flexible, and user-friendly, providing the necessary support without unnecessary complexity or cost. Stronger Cybersecurity Measures
Cyberthreats are a constant concern, which means your security measures should be equally persistent. Among the most effective defences against these threats is the implementation of multi-factor authentication, which adds additional layers of security to the login process. Regular security audits are also essential to identify and address vulnerabilities before they can be exploited by hackers. Finally, encrypted backups ensure that your data remains secure, even in the event of a breach.

24/7 Support
Tech issues don’t follow a 9-to-5 schedule. A reliable provider should offer round-the-clock support, so you’re never left stranded when problems arise. Fast response times can mean the difference between a minor glitch and a major business disruption.
Strong Security Focus
With cyber threats growing daily, IT security isn’t optional—it’s essential. Choose a provider that prioritises:
- Proactive monitoring: Detect threats before they become a problem.
- Regular security updates: Keep your systems protected against the latest risks.
- Compliance assistance: Ensure your business meets Australian data protection laws.
